Unconfined heavy-fermion model of the upsilons
Description
It is considered the possibility that the upsilon peaks are bound states of F and anti F, where F is a heavy spin-1/2 particle with integral charge. The presently known spectroscopy of the upsilons, neglecting spin effects, can readily be reproduced by a simple potential (which, of course, allows also for the existence of unconfined continuum states of F anti F as well). Predictions are made concerning hadronic production of upsilons, widths of the upsilon system, and other experimental signatures which might differentiate the model from the conventional b-quark picture.
